From: Dynamic regulation of mRNA decay during neural development
mRNAs stabilized in the nervous system (neural/whole embryo half-life >1.5) | |||||
---|---|---|---|---|---|
GO term | Definition | P value | FDR | Count | Fold enrichment |
007409 | Axonogenesis | 2 × 10−3 | .06 | 13 | 2.8 |
APC, CadN, trio, caps, fray, otk, daw | |||||
0003924 | GTPase activity | 2 × 10−3 | .31 | 10 | 3.5 |
Rab21, Rab30, Ras64B, RabX1 | |||||
0009312 | Oligosaccharide biosynthesis | 9 × 10−3 | .15 | 4 | 9.2 |
mgat2, GalNAc-T1, pgant2, pgant5 | |||||
0045196 | Establishment of neuroblast polarity | .01 | .16 | 3 | 18.7 |
par-6, baz, Lgl | |||||
0007269 | Neurotransmitter secretion | .04 | .56 | 6 | 2.6 |
CanB, Lgl, CASK, Dap160, cpx, rop | |||||
mRNAs destabilized in the nervous system (neural/whole embryo half-life <0.6) | |||||
GO term | Definition | P value | FDR | Count | Fold enrichment |
0003735 | Structural constituent of ribosome | 5 × 10−17 | 5 × 10−15 | 26 | 9.2 |
RpL11, RpL30, RpL6, RpS16, RpS23 | |||||
0000278 | Mitotic cell cycle | 4 × 10−8 | 4 × 10−5 | 30 | 3.2 |
dap, cycB3, ball, glu, eff, ncd, mts | |||||
0031497 | Chromatin assembly | 3 × 10−4 | .02 | 7 | 7.5 |
H2B, H3, H3.3A/B, HP2, Df31, Set | |||||
0005839 | Proteasome core complex | 8 × 10−3 | .07 | 5 | 6.0 |
Pros26, Prosα7, Prosβ2, Prosβ7 | |||||
0006119 | Oxidative phosphorylation | 6 × 10−4 | .03 | 12 | 3.5 |
ATPsynB, ATPsynD, mt:CoIII |
